The American Institute of Certified Public Accountants (AICPA) has partnered with the Nigerian Capital Market Institute to provide Nigerian businesses with access to advanced governance and risk management training. This collaboration will enable finance professionals to develop expertise in internal controls and enterprise risk management, essential tools for navigating today's complex business environment. The training programmes, developed by the Committee of Sponsoring Organizations of the Treadway Commission (COSO), will focus on designing, implementing, and monitoring internal controls, as well as managing risks such as errors, fraud, and mismanagement. By strengthening their governance frameworks, Nigerian businesses can protect their assets, promote business continuity, and enhance investor confidence.
The COSO Internal Control Certificate Programme will equip finance professionals with the skills to develop and maintain effective internal controls, while the COSO Enterprise Risk Management Certificate Programme will teach the concepts and principles of the updated ERM framework. This knowledge will enable businesses to integrate risk management into their strategy-setting process, driving business performance and resilience.
